  17. This is silly. You aren't getting "what he'd get in free agency four years in advance". If Giolito was who he is today and hit free agency at age 29, he would not get a 1 year, (let's say) $25 million deal. He may get a multi year deal worth maybe 5 years 125 million, where his age 30 season is expected to be his most productive, and age 34 season least productive, but it allows them to allocate and plan for that long term. You also get: - Cost certainty of his arb numbers for next three years - Guaranteed control for four years. But if you may as well just wait and sign him as a free agent, you are going to need to give him a lot more years, a lot more money, and pay him a lot more for the years he is MUCH more likely to be worse because of aging. And if you want to talk about things hard to get rid of - it's a lot easier to get rid of an expensive underperforming pitcher than it is an expensive underperforming hitter. Yet they were fine paying Robert and Moncada "free agency" money for just another year.
